Let's get started with the first act which is 9 year old Jalen. I might mention that each of the acts tells us a little something about themselves before they perform and also Paula once again works with each contestant.
Jalen does a wow job with his hip-hop as he performs to the songs "Everybody Dance Now", "Hey, Ho" and "Can't Touch This". Each of the judges are impressed as am I and he earns three gold stars.
Next up is Dance In Flight who have been together for 10 years. They are an older couple who give us an act to the music of Paula Abdul's "Opposite Attract" and some "Pink Panther" music. I thought this couple was sort of cute but in reality they did not dance much but did alot of lifts that did not always go good. I applaud their efforts as did the judges however they only got two gold stars.
Twitch appears next and does a unusual dance to the song "Apologize". It seemed like they were telling a story and I liked it. The judges did too and gave them 3 gold stars. This group is very good and their male dancer is awesome. I hope they go far.
I was a shocked that the judges did not appreciate the talents of the next contestant who is Du Shaunt Stegall. I loved his moves as he dances to the song "OMG" by Usher. This kid can really dance and in spite of the 3 red stars our judges gave him I am so hoping some executive viewing this kid give him a shot.
Dax and Sarah are next but sadly Dax has been suffering with a bad back throughout the week. During rehearsal we see his back acts up again and Paula insists he go to see a doctor. The doctor gives him a temporary fix so he can dance his number. Their theme this week is a French setting as they do their lindy hop. Dax does well but overall the dance was kind of boring so had to agree with the red star given by Travis Payne. Kimberley and Paula gave them gold.
I love the beauty that White Tree Fine Art give when they dance. Tonight was no exception as they tell a story while they dance to the song "Hallelujah". The lifts were great! Kimberley gives them a standing ovation. Travis was so wrong to give them a red star because he just does not feel their vibe. The audience wants him to change his vote but he keeps the red. Paula gives them gold.
Now comes the judges choice for who will move on to the finals and I am thrilled knowing that White Tree Fine Art is moving on.
